Web8 de jul. de 2024 · 2) Whole grains. Whole grains include all parts of the natural grain. They are known as germ, endosperm, and bran. The most common whole grains are whole wheat, brown rice, oats, rye, barley, buckwheat, and quinoa. These whole grains are enriched with fibers and decrease cholesterol levels, reducing heart diseases.

WebSpinach: Vitamin C is often associated with citrus fruits, but leafy greens like spinach, kale and romaine are also particularly rich sources. Not only that, but spinach may help increase your nitric oxide levels thanks to its high level of nitrates. Spinach is also a great source of potassium in your diet.
